“…Guo and his colleagues 106 designed a novel nanoplatform to effectively combine photodynamic therapy and chemotherapy. The prepared nanoplatform contained mesoporous silica nanoparticles (MSNs) as the nanocarrier, Au nanoparticles on the surface of MSNs as the photosensitizer, thiol-modified polyethylene glycol (mPEG-SH) coated on the nanostructure via Au–S bonds as the reduction-responsive gate-keeper and drug doxorubicin, which was loaded into MSN-Au-PEG via pore adsorption (Fig.…”
